Job Summary and Qualifications The OR Radiologic Technologist is responsible to facilitate communication, coordination, cooperation and problem resolution regarding daily technical operations between the Operating Room and the Radiology Department. Ensures radiologic coverage and smooth transition between Operating Room cases. Maintains open communication with subordinates and acts as liaison to promote positive interaction with Hospital/OR staff, patients, family members and Medical Staff. Functions as a staff technologist as necessitated by daily workload. Performs those duties directly involved with a variety of technical procedures utilizing ionizing radiation for the purpose of detecting pathology. Regulates the equipment used to produce and process images. Assists in the daily operations of the Radiology Department. Establishes and maintains a good rapport and professional relationship with fellow employees, other departments and Medical Staff.
